Types of Replacement Handles For UPVC Windows

Window handles made of Upvc must be replaced in order to preserve their integrity and aesthetic appearance. These handles come in various sizes and shapes that allow you to customize the look of your windows based on your personal preferences.

Espag

Espag handles are the most sought-after type of window handle for uPVC windows. Because of the spindle at the back of the handle, they are known as spindle handles. There are a variety of types to choose from, depending on your personal taste.

You can choose between inline or cranked handles. Cranked handles are better for windows that are near the frame's edge. Cranked handles give more space for the operator to open the windows. However, these handles are not as versatile as other uPVC window systems.

Espag handles are also available in various shades. The color you choose will depend on your preference and the style of your upvc sash windows windows. A screw cap that matches the colour of your window can reduce the appearance of modern sight lines.

Aluminium alloy is used to create Espag handles. The handles' smooth design ensures the highest level of comfort. These handles work with existing uPVC window spindles.

In order to operate the espag locking mechanism, the spindle needs to be properly measured. To do this take a measurement of the spindle from the base of the handle to the end of the spindle. Use the tape measure to measure the length of your spindle.

Typically, the length is about 43mm between the fixing screws. If you have a larger window, you might think about changing the center of the screw holes. upvc windows repairs Windows Possil Park and Barnstaple technicians can help you on this.

Espag handles are a great option to increase security for windows that are glazed. You can quickly escape an emergency with a simple push-to-release lock

You can buy espag window handles that have a key-locking system, fire escape locking as well as the secure by design lock. A good quality espag handrail will be able to meet your needs, no matter if you are seeking a fresh style or a change to a conventional uPVC window.

Cockspur

Cockspur window handles are a great alternative for worn out, old window handles. They are usually found on windows constructed of upvc window repairs near me but certain wooden windows also have them. They come in a variety of colours such as black, white and brushed nickel.

A cockspur handle secures over a striker plate that is made of plastic. It can be used in conjunction with a wedge to ensure the window is shut tightly. These are easy to fit and can be modified to fit different sizes of windows.

The Cockspur is a well-loved replacement for window handles due to its many features. The Espag, a spindle-type handle with an locking mechanism is available in the U.S. Both of these products are available in different sizes and shapes.

The cockspur's nose is secured to the frame when it is closed. They are simple to install and are suitable for both left and right-handed windows. Certain cockspur window handles are designed to be adjusted to accommodate different sizes and types of windows.

It's also a good idea to utilize cockspurs since they allow you to turn the window 90 degrees and secure it in place. The cockspur accomplishes this by pulling the spur along a wedge of plastic. It may sound difficult, but it's a very simple process.

One of the easiest methods to replace the window handle is to remove the blade, then put in a window wedge. Windows are often fitted with three or four screws. It is crucial to examine the thickness of the blade prior to you make this change. The size of the wedge will help ensure that the cockspur has the capacity to pull the window firmly into its closed position.

Venetian

Venetian handles are a stylish and traditional alternative to window handles. They also work for older UPVC windows. Depending on the kind of window that you have, you may pick from a variety designs and sizes.

Contrary to other window handles, Venetian handles are fixed to the window and will not cut through blinds. They are usually fixed to the frame using two bolts. The handle may have a slim projection so it isn't visible from outside. It has a polished look.

These handles are easy to put in. They can be right-handed or left-handed. You can also choose from different styles of spindle length. Some are up to 55mm long.

There are many features you can select from, including a tilt and turn feature. Additionally the handles are designed to work with all kinds of blinds for windows.

UPVC window handles are available in various styles and finishes. They are available for older windows, as well as windows with a metal frame. They are often used in high-rise apartments and commercial buildings.

No matter what design you select, make sure that you have the correct length. For instance, if you are replacing an existing handle, it is important to verify the step height. A proper step height is vital when you're installing the handle to seal the window.

If your current handle has a broken spindle that is broken, you must buy a new one. You can also hire an expert to take measurements of the steps. This will help you determine the right spindle length for the replacement.

The standard fixing center for a Venetian handle is 43mm. Most UPVC windows have a step height of 21mm.
